Factors Influencing Health-Related Quality of Life of Overweight and Obese Children in South Korea
Kim, Hee Soon; Park, Jiyoung; Ma, Yumi; Ham, Ok Kyung
Journal of School Nursing, v29 n5 p361-369 Oct 2013
The purpose of this study was to identify factors influencing health-related quality of life (HRQoL) of overweight and obese children in Korea. This study employed a cross-sectional descriptive study design. A total of 132 overweight and obese children participated in the study. Anthropometric measurements included body mass index, percent body fat, and waist--hip ratio. The instruments included lifestyle patterns, psychosocial characteristics (stress, self-esteem, and depression), and HRQoL. The study found that significant predictors of HRQoL included self-esteem, depression, and physical stress; these variables accounted for 58.7% of the variance (p < 0.05), while children with low monthly household income had significantly lower HRQoL, compared with that of their counterparts (p < 0.05). HRQoL has multiple dimensions, thus, in addition to lifestyle change, health programs for overweight and obese children should focus on psychological health, and consider social and environmental factors as well.
